[*] For you VZ Blackberry owners out there: Which OS does VZ currently provide? 4.5x? And does VZ make OS upgrades available, for any of their devices?


The VZW blackberries (not including the storm) are all on 4.5.77
I am not sure what the storm is on, I don't follow all the storm talk.

VZW does give their BB OS updates when VZW is ready to release them. They just released the OS for the 8830, however I have had the current OS for my 8330 for a couple of months. I hear that OS 5.0 will be on the new BB being released whenever VZW decides to release them.

I don't know the site off the top of my hand, but if you google Verizon Blackberry Updates, you can see on the website what OS is out for each BB and when the OS was released.

One would think once the new BB are released that the 8830 and 8330 OS may update as well to 5.0 if that is what is on the new BB.
